On Thu, Jul 25, 2024 at 09:31:01AM +0800, Cindy Lu wrote:
> Add support for setting the MAC address using the VDPA tool.
> This feature will allow setting the MAC address using the VDPA tool.
> For example, in vdpa_sim_net, the implementation sets the MAC address
> to the config space. However, for other drivers, they can implement their
> own function, not limited to the config space.

[...]

Nit: the subject line has misspelled PATCH as PATH

I believe net-next is still closed so this code needs to be resent
when net-next is open again in a few days.
